ALBANY — A 39-year-old Albany man has been charged in connection with a narcotics investigation.
On Tuesday, Aug. 19 around 9:10 a.m., detectives from the Albany Police Department’s Community Response Unit executed a search warrant at a residence on Thurlow Terrace as part of an ongoing narcotics investigation.
During the search warrant, detectives recovered a quantity of crack cocaine.
Jason Bryant, 39, was located inside the residence and was taken into custody.
A second search warrant was subsequently executed at a storage locker belonging to Bryant at U-Haul located at 139 Broadway in connection with the same investigation.
During this search warrant, detectives recovered a loaded .357 revolver, a loaded 9mm ghost gun, and a loaded .22 caliber handgun.
Bryant has been charged with three counts of Criminal Possession of a Weapon 2nd, three counts of Criminal Possession of a Weapon 3rd, one count of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ance 3rd, one count of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ance 5th, and one count of Criminally Using Drug Paraphernalia 2nd.
He was arraigned Wednesday afternoon in Albany City Criminal Court and remanded to the Albany County Jail.
